Home Gardener's Herb Gardens is the essential guide to growing herbs
and designing, planting, improving, and caring for herb gardens. People
now use herbs in their cooking on an everyday basis and there's nothing
nicer than being able to go out into your garden, snip some fresh herbs
and put them straight into the pot. The beauty of an herb garden is that
it does not have to be big - it can be part of a larger garden or it can
merely be a window box. More than 330 color illustrations and diagrams,
backed with easily followed text, help gardeners at all skill levels
learn to buy, plant, tend, and harvest a rich bounty of herbs. Complete
herb identification and growing instructions are provided for annuals,
biennials, bulbs, herbaceous perennials, and shrub-like herbs. There are
also planting patterns for a compact cartwheel garden, corner and narrow
planting beds, and formal herb gardens, and much more--plus information
on preparing herbs for culinary use.
